Region MuggyMeter Through Sunday

One of the noteworthy experiences this Spring has been the lack of thick humidity around the Region. While that directly relates to our lack of rain and dry soil, it also has a lot to do with wind direction as our wind has rarely been out of the south or southwest (which brings that tropical air out of the Gulf of Mexico). That being said we’re turning a bit more humid this week, but not terrible by any means as our wind will be out of the east (NE and SE) as an area of low pressure swirls for days to our south. By the weekend you notice we turn humid–that’s with our next system that looks to produce some much-needed rain on Sunday.
